Step by Step Tutorial on How to Change Username in Instagram

Changing your Instagram username is a simple process that can be done in just a few taps. Here’s how to do it:

Step 1: Open Instagram and go to your profile

Once you’re on your profile, you’ll be able to access your account settings where you can change your username.

Step 2: Tap on ‘Edit Profile’

This will take you to a new screen where you can edit various aspects of your profile, including your username.

Step 3: Tap on the ‘Username’ field and enter your new username

Make sure your new username is unique and hasn’t been taken by someone else.

Step 4: Tap ‘Done’ or ‘Save’ to confirm the change

Congratulations! You’ve successfully changed your Instagram username.

After you’ve changed your username, your profile will be updated with your new name, and your followers will see the change the next time they visit your profile.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can I change my username back to my old one?

If your old username hasn’t been taken by someone else, you can change it back.

How often can I change my username?

You can change your username as often as you like, but it’s best to stick with one that your followers can easily remember.

Will changing my username affect my followers?

No, changing your username will not affect your followers or following list.

Can I reserve a username in case I want to change it later?

Instagram does not allow users to reserve usernames.

What happens if the username I want is already taken?

You’ll need to choose a different username that is not already in use.
